Common Applications of Aluminum Cast Parts in Various Industries
Aluminum cast components are broadly applied across numerous industries due to their exceptional properties and advantages. In the automotive sector, manufacturers utilize these components for engine blocks, transmission housings, and structural frames, capitalizing on their lightweight nature and corrosion resistance. The aerospace industry also uses aluminum casting for parts like brackets and housings, which contribute to reduced weight and improved fuel efficiency.
Within the construction industry, aluminum castings are utilized in window frames, door frames, and roofing materials, boosting durability and aesthetic appeal. Additionally, the electrical industry commonly employs aluminum cast parts in enclosures and heat sinks, guaranteeing efficient thermal management.
The marine industry values aluminum for its protection against saltwater corrosion, applying it to components such as boat hulls and engine parts. On the whole, the versatility of aluminum cast parts makes them indispensable across various applications, improving performance and durability in diverse fields.
Essential Aluminum Casting Techniques for Custom Part Creation
Numerous essential techniques are utilized in aluminum casting to generate custom parts that address specific design standards. One prevalent method is sand casting, which entails creating a mold from sand and pouring molten aluminum into it. This technique is optimal for complex shapes and supports efficient production of small to medium-sized parts.
Another method is die casting, where molten aluminum is pushed into a metal mold under high pressure. This process is ideal for high-volume production and ensures excellent dimensional accuracy and surface finish.
Investment casting, also known as lost-wax casting, is an alternative technique that allows for complex patterns and refined surface quality. This process entails producing a wax pattern that gets covered with a ceramic coating, which is subsequently heated to eliminate the wax and solidify the coating prior to introducing aluminum.
These techniques collectively enhance the flexibility and effectiveness of aluminum casting for customized industrial applications.

How to Maintain High Quality in Aluminum Casting
Preserving excellent quality in aluminum casting is essential for securing the durability and performance of cast parts. To achieve this, several key elements must be addressed throughout the casting process. First, selecting top-quality aluminum alloys can considerably affect the final product's strength and resistance to corrosion. Additionally, maintaining accurate temperature control during melting and pouring is essential, as variations can cause defects such as porosity or inclusions.
Applying rigorous quality control measures, including non-destructive testing and dimensional inspections, verifies that any issues are spotted early. Furthermore, using cutting-edge casting techniques, such as investment casting detailed resource or die casting, can boost accuracy and surface finish. Ultimately, continuous training for personnel involved in the casting process promotes a culture of quality awareness, fostering attention to detail. By concentrating on these aspects, manufacturers can consistently create premium aluminum castings that address the specific needs of their clients.

Which Post-Casting Services Are Offered for Aluminum Parts?
Services after casting for aluminum parts typically include machining, surface finishing, heat treatment, inspection, and assembly. These extra processes elevate the final product's accuracy, durability, and overall quality, making certain it meets designated industry standards and customer requirements.
